By Chenault onAs a college student and a server, it is important that I have a relaible ink pen at all times. I also look for unique pens as many of my coworkers have a bad habit of walking off with your ink pen. I saw the bright vibrant neon assortment by Magna Blast, and I knew I could easily identify my pen if I were using these pens.
At a fair price of about fifty cents each, I din't hesitate to purchase this package of pens. Overall the pens write decently for the price. The colors are bright and enjoyable. However these ink pens do 'skip' and they aren't ideal for class assignments, but they work fine at work, writing orders.
I probably won't buy the Magna Blast again, but that is just because I rarely buy the same ink pen twice, unless it is an exceptional writing tool.
The Magna blast neon colors assortment would be ideal for high school girls, or anyone just looking to spice up their hand writing.

The Magna Blast Neon pens have a 0.8 mm medium point and do indeed skip. But, if you purchase the Magna Tank pens (in the same "Magna" family) you will not be disappointed in the least. These have a 0.5 mm fine point and never skip. Im serious...I have had pack after pack after pack of these and they are amazing, especially when you are writing mass amounts of notes in class everyday. My only complaint is this....when you drop one of these pens and it lands on the writing point, youre screwed. The pen does not flow nearly as well, seems to have a great deal of friction against the paper, and skips. For a pack of 5 colors its less than 3 dollars at Wal-Mart...definitely worth it!
